What Is Laminated Wood Flooring?

Direct Flooring Advisory:
Laminated wood flooring is a multi-layered flooring system with a photographic wood-look layer and a protective wear layer over a fiberboard core.
It offers the appearance of hardwood while remaining more affordable and moisture-resistant, suitable for Kenyan homes and offices.

Technical Specifications of Laminated Wood Flooring

SpecificationTypical Range at Ali Glaziers
Plank Length1200mm – 1400mm
Plank Width190mm – 210mm
Total Thickness7mm – 12mm
Wear LayerAC3 (residential) / AC4 (commercial)
Core TypeHDF (High-Density Fiberboard)
Installation TypeClick-Lock Floating System
Moisture ResistanceModerate (avoid standing water)

These specifications ensure that laminated wood flooring performs well in Kenyan climate conditions and high-traffic environments.


Installation Guide for Laminated Wood Flooring

Direct Flooring Advisory:
Proper subfloor preparation, plank alignment, and expansion gap allowance are critical for a long-lasting laminated floor in Nairobi homes.
Click-lock installation allows easy floating floor setup without adhesives.

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Prepare Subfloor: Ensure it is level, dry, and clean.

  2. Lay Underlay: Optional foam underlay provides sound absorption and comfort.

  3. Install Planks: Start from one corner, interlock planks, and maintain 8–10mm expansion gaps.

  4. Trim and Fit: Cut planks for edges and around doorways.

  5. Install Skirting: Cover expansion gaps and add a polished finish.

Cost Considerations in Nairobi

Direct Flooring Advisory:
Laminated wood flooring costs KES 2,000 – 3,500 per sqm in Kenya, depending on plank thickness, AC wear rating, and design.
Installation costs are additional, averaging KES 400–700 per sqm for professional fitting.

Maintenance Tips for Longevity

Direct Flooring Advisory:
Routine cleaning and proper care prevent scratches, moisture damage, and discoloration, extending the lifespan of laminated floors.

  • Sweep or vacuum regularly to remove grit

  • Use a damp mop with mild detergent

  • Avoid standing water or excessive moisture

  • Place furniture pads to prevent dents

  • Inspect seams and edges periodically


Laminated Wood vs Hardwood: What You Need to Know

Direct Flooring Advisory:
Laminated wood offers the visual appeal of hardwood with lower cost, easier installation, and improved resistance to daily wear and Kenyan climate conditions.
Hardwood may require refinishing and is more sensitive to moisture and temperature changes.

FeatureLaminated WoodHardwood
CostLow-MediumHigh
DurabilityHighMedium-High
Moisture ResistanceModerateLow
MaintenanceLowHigh
InstallationEasy, DIY-FriendlyProfessional Required
